Description


Well established NYC based real estate firm with an extensive record of success in the development and acquisition of office, residential, retail and hotel properties has an immediate need for a Project Manager. The successful candidate must have extensive and directly related hands on experience in commercial office and retail properties in NYC.

Responsibilities:

Manages all phases of project management including design, construction, occupancy and quality control.

Establish and manages cost controls and documentation to properly manage the project budget.

Continuously evaluate the design and construction progress and team performances to ensure project meets schedules and within budget.

Tracks progress of projects against goals, objectives, timelines, and budgets, and generates reports on status. 

Where required, prepares scopes of work, solicits proposals, assembles RFP’s, negotiates contracts and prepares other project documentation to properly organize and manage the operations.

Responsible for the successful commissioning and turnover of the project. This shall include but not be limited to managing the punch-list process and required close-out documents.

Works closely with other functional areas of the organization, project contractors, internal team members, external collaborators and vendors. 


Qualifications:

BS in Architecture, Civil Engineering, Construction Management, Industrial Technology or a related Surveying/ Construction Economics degree or equivalent experience.

Minimum of 5 years of construction related experience.

Demonstrated ability in the areas of construction management, mastery in field operations, scheduling, budgeting, cost control, financial reporting and client relationships.

Able to recognize situations/ problems develop alternative solutions and implement decisions compatible with company goals.

Excellent organizational, leadership, analytical and oral presentation and written communication skills are needed.

Proven proficiency in word, excel, scheduling software, and various software packages as required by specific position.

Proven ability to work independently.

Proven ability to perform a variety of critical and often confidential tasks with constantly changing priorities.

Proven ability to meet deadlines, carry through assignments and exhibit accuracy and neatness.

Proven ability to interact, develop and maintain a positive working relationship with personnel on all levels, both within and outside the company.

Proven ability to respond to varying situations with tact, diplomacy and professionalism.

Must be comfortable working under pressure.
